Transaction d23695d22282eda56a450bea6e3e52e7a865eee75d8a1ae10894b2f3bfabe4fb
1 Input
1 Output
-
d23695d22282eda56a450bea6e3e52e7a865eee75d8a1ae10894b2f3bfabe4fb:0
- value
- 2809379
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05030b12ed437ac717cfbae8d17c63cdd2e26c40 OP_EQUAL
- address
- 329WwxBH3uppzKB4BEwpQkpKygKDhtSBK7